Why birds don’t get electic shocks even though they sit on the bare wire? The flow of electricity depends on three things – (1) a path of least resistance (2) best conductor (3) A complete circuit. To make a complete circuit, electricity always needs to find out a way to the ground. That means it needs a complete circuit to flow. If birds are sitting on a single wire, they will not get electric shocks because they are bad conductor for electricity and don’t make a complete circuit. #Science
